- How I combined the best of @poteto's pstack and @kunchenguid's Firstmate into a single runtime. Instead of letting their routers fight as separate authorities, I kept Firstmate as the outer loop for fleet orchestration and injected pstack's engineering discipline directly into the workers runtime. >Firstmate is a fleet commander (horizontal scale across Git worktrees). >pstack is an elite micro-manager (strict engineering habits and verification). Here is how I merged them into an optimized hybrid runtime: * Conditional Briefs: Worker prompts load plays just-in-time. Zero bloated prompt dumps. * Required-Read Habits: Smallest logical change, subtract code before adding, and analyze blast radius. * Context Discipline: Only map how the system is built when the change crosses into another part of it. If you skip that, write one line saying why. * Verification: "Done" requires real artifact proof (running live shell commands or generating local app verifiers). * Scaffold Isolation: Worktree checks prevent role hijack across ship, scout, and supervisor agents. I stripped out the Cursor UI dependencies for my local machine's CLI stack and skipped the expensive multi-frontier review loops. Firstmate handles the fleet isolation. The injected runtime handles the code discipline. The goal is lean, fast and deterministic.
